what do you think is the best way to change a colour image from cmyk (or rgb) to a black and white image that isn't greyscale. that is, that is cmyk in order to print
simply desaturate. depending on the program you use, this can be done with several different tools. but, basically, all you're doing is removing the color without changing the file type/format.
